A FRENCH BRONZE MODEL OF DIANA THE HUNTRESS
LAST QUARTER 19TH CENTURY
After the Antique, with 'REDUCTION MECANIQUE' stamp, on a later stained wood plinth
The bronze -- 16 in. (40.5 cm.) high

Lot Essay

The present lot is after the antique marble of the virgin huntress now housed in the Louvre, Paris. The marble was first recorded in 1586 in Fontainbleau but was later moved under Louis XIV to the Grande Galerie at Versailles and finally to the Louvre in 1789. F. Haskell and N. Penny, Taste and the Antique - The Lure of Classical Sculpture 1500-1900, New Haven and London, 1981, no. 30.
